Police investigating after two teens shot near Kansas City school
KANSAS CITY, Mo. - Two people were shot near a Kansas City, Missouri school Wednesday night, according to police. The shooting was reported around 8:30 p.m. in the area of E. 63rd and Paseo Boulevard. Police said during a basketball game at Ewing Marion Kauffman School, an off-duty officer heard gunshots across the street.
